St. Mary's Cathedral is a Catholic cathedral located in Ogdensburg, New York, United States. It is the seat of the Diocese of Ogdensburg.[3] St. Mary's parish was founded in 1827. The original St. Mary's Cathedral was located at Montgomery and Franklin Streets.[4] The cornerstone was laid in 1855 and it was destroyed in a fire on November 25, 1947. The current cathedral was completed in 1952 and consecrated on October 22 of that year.[5]
